Requirements:
  • Develop, implement, and maintain robust manufacturing processes for new and existing products
  • Create and manage process documentation, including work instructions, routers, PFMEAs, and control plans
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(Engineering, Quality, Production, Supply Chain) to ensure efficient product flow and manufacturability
  • Support new product introduction (NPI) activities, including process validation and first article inspections (FAI)
  • Analyze process performance and implement improvements to increase efficiency, reduce waste, and improve quality
  • Troubleshoot manufacturing issues on the shop floor and implement corrective actions
  • Ensure processes meet customer, regulatory, and industry standards (e.g., AS9100, NADCAP where applicable)
  • Drive standardization of best practices across multiple cells, machines, and product families
  • Support capacity planning and tooling/fixture design requirements
  • Utilize data and metrics to monitor process capability (Cp/Cpk) and drive continuous improvement initiatives
  • Participate in internal and external audits as needed

Knowledge, skills, and abilities   

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, or related field
  • 3+ years of experience in a process engineering role or manufacturing environment
  • Experience with process documentation and quality systems
  •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ings and GD&T
  • Strong problem-solving and analytical skills
  • Experience in aerospace and defense manufacturing environments
  • Familiarity with AS9100 and/or NADCAP requirements
  • Knowledge of lean manufacturing and continuous improvement methodologies (Six Sigma, Kaizen, etc.)
